Victory Lane Challenge is a free game and runs for 10 weeks, beginning with the Daytona 500 race on February 20th and ending with the Darlington 500 on May 7th. The complete schedule is listed at the bottom of this page.
You're the boss, you make the call! Build your race team's lineup, by picking one (1) driver from each of the eight (8) driver groups. Choose new drivers each week.
Each week your drivers earn fantasy points based on their actual Sprint Cup series race points. The overall prizes are based on your points over the 10 racing weeks. See Scoring for an explanation of the Sprint Cup point system.
Because each race has a different field list, Head2Head Sports changes the driver groups each week. Registration for each race becomes available each Tuesday.
Remember, your drivers do not carry over from week to week so your lineup must be submitted by the weekly deadline of Friday at Midnight PT. If you don't make any selections, you will not receive any points for that week.
Play one week or all 10 weeks!
Weekly results and standings are posted each Monday.
